Chemical Properties

Liquid chlorine is a solution of sodium hypochlorite (NaOCl) in water. It has a strong oxidizing power, which makes it effective for disinfection. The typical concentration ranges between 10% and 15%, depending on the product.

It is unstable when exposed to sunlight and heat, which means you should store it in a cool, dark place. Its freezing point is lower than water’s due to the chemicals dissolved in it, usually around -17°C (1.4°F). So, in most household freezers, liquid chlorine won’t freeze solid.

Common Uses

Liquid chlorine is widely used to keep swimming pools clean by killing bacteria and algae. It’s also applied in water treatment plants to ensure safe drinking water. In some cases, it’s used for sanitizing surfaces in hospitals and food processing facilities.

Proper Storage Tips

Store liquid chlorine in a cool, dry place away from direct sunlight. A shaded shed or a well-ventilated garage works well. Avoid storing it directly on concrete floors; instead, place it on wooden pallets or plastic mats to prevent temperature fluctuations.

Keep the container tightly sealed to prevent moisture and contaminants from entering. This also helps maintain the chemical’s stability. Have you checked if your storage space is well-ventilated? Good airflow reduces the risk of condensation, which can accelerate freezing.

Temperature Control Methods

Maintaining a stable temperature above freezing is key. If your storage area gets too cold, consider using a space heater or heat lamps safely to keep the temperature steady. Even a small heat source can make a big difference in preventing the liquid from freezing.

Another option is insulating the container with foam or thermal blankets designed for chemical storage. These materials trap heat and protect against sudden temperature drops. Have you ever tried wrapping your chlorine container? It might be the simple fix you need during cold nights.

Monitor the temperature regularly using a thermometer placed near the chlorine. Early detection of dropping temperatures lets you act before freezing occurs. Wouldn’t you prefer to catch the problem early rather than dealing with a ruined container later?

Other Disinfectants

You can consider several other disinfectants besides liquid chlorine:

  • Chlorine Tablets:These are slow-dissolving and easy to store. They release chlorine steadily, which means fewer dosing adjustments.
  • Bromine:Effective in hot tubs and spas, bromine works well at higher temperatures where chlorine might lose strength.
  • Saltwater Systems:These generate chlorine from salt, providing a gentler and continuous sanitizing effect without storing harsh chemicals.
  • UV and Ozone Systems:Non-chemical options that disinfect water by destroying microorganisms, often used alongside low levels of chlorine or bromine.
